The linear complementarity problem (LCP ) belongs to the class of NP-complete problems. Therefore we can not expect a polynomial time solution method for LCP s without requiring some special property of the matrix of the problem. It is common to identify the class of computable functions with the class of functions computable by the Turing machine. The identification is done on the ground of the famous Church-Turing thesis. In fact, the thesis justifies only one implication: computable function are Turing computable. The other implication is quite obviously false if computability means practical computability.
